NTPC has developed a standalone solar microgrid system that uses hydrogen as the storage medium to deliver 200 kW of round-the-clock power throughout the year. Designed to replace diesel gensets at off-grid Army locations, the system provides a reliable and sustainable power supply even in harsh winter conditions, where temperatures can drop to –40 C at an altitude of 4,500 meters.

In its latest monthly column for pv magazine, the International Solar Energy Society (ISES) promotes the biennial Solar World Congress (SWC), which took place in Fortaleza-Brazil in November 2025, a few days before the COP30. The SWC scientific program has traditionally been dominated by presentations on solar radiation and solar thermal applications, but this year, photovoltaics was the focus of most of the presentations. This reflects the massive adoption of PV all over the globe, which, at the current pace, will dominate the electricity mix by the end of the decade.

Scientists in China have proposed a novel scheduling framework for microgrids based on hybrid PV and a small modular nuclear reactors. The framework uses multi-objective distributionally robust optimization with a real-time reinforcement learning mechanism and is reportedly able to reduce operational costs by 18.7%.
